Snow sweeper
The invention discloses a snow sweeper. The snow sweeper comprises a main body and an operation assembly, the main body comprises a snow throwing part; the flow guide plate is connected to the snow throwing part; the first driving device is used for driving the snow throwing part to rotate around a first axis relative to the main body; the second driving device is used for driving the guide plate to rotate around a second axis relative to the snow throwing piece; the first axis is perpendicular to the second axis; the operation assembly at least comprises an operation piece used for controlling the first driving device or the second driving device to operate. The first driving device at least comprises a first motor; the second driving device at least comprises a second motor; when the snow throwing piece is located in the middle position, the first motor and the second motor are both located in a first circular area with the second axis as the center, and the radius of the first circular area is smaller than or equal to 800 mm. By the adoption of the technical scheme, the snow sweeper is higher in snow throwing angle adjusting precision, more stable in structure, more convenient and more labor-saving.
